       The Committee on Budget (Joyner) recommended the following:
       
    1         Senate Amendment (with title amendment)
    2  
    3         Delete lines 679 - 690
    4  and insert:
    5  of racial profiling. When a law enforcement officer issues a
    6  citation for a violation of this section, the law enforcement
    7  officer must record the race and ethnicity of the violator. All
    8  law enforcement agencies must maintain such information and
    9  forward the information to the department in a form and manner
   10  determined by the department. The department shall collect this
   11  information by jurisdiction and annually report the data to the
   12  custodian of state records and make the report electronically
   13  available to the public Governor, the President of the Senate,
   14  and the Speaker of the House of Representatives. The report must
   15  show separate statewide totals for the state’s county sheriffs
   16  and municipal law enforcement agencies, state law enforcement
   17  agencies, and state university law enforcement agencies.
